so i'm running 4 gigs of ram in my system, however, in my system information, it only says i'm running 3.50 gbs. i know the other .50 wouldn't really make a difference but i'm just curious why my systems only recognizing 3.5 instead of 4. ntune is also recognizing all four gigs and i've set my primary video adapter to my pci-e so it doesn't use onboard shared vid memory, but could there be something else i didn't do? any help will be greatly appreciated! thanks!
 
If you are using windows xp, is because windows xp has a ram limit or at least the 32bits versions, 64 bits os and vista doesn't do this.

It is a RAM limit but it's because all the devices on your PC need to be addressable and they use the address range that is around the 3-4GB range because so few people actaully have that much RAM and fewer actually use it.
